This season, we all want to wear a hat, and not just for weddings. Following Kate and Wills wedding in April, Philip Treacy is a household name, a hat can make £81k and stores are reporting a surge in interest in millinery. Hat sales at John Lewis are up 60% and Kate Middletons favourite Sloane Square department store Peter Jones offers a \'Hat Academy\' personal shopping service throughout June, helping its customers choose from over 200 styles.
\r\nWe caught up with milliner Louis Mariette to get his top tips for how to wear a hat: \"A hat makes a visual statement within seconds; it is an accessory that is bold and powerful that reflects the wearers personality and style: whether demure or extrovert. An outfit executed with style, elegance and backed up with controlled composure, will always be a winner!\"
\r\nRead on for Louis top tips for choosing a hat, and some inspirational looks from Epsom and Royal Ascot.

\"It is critical that you are totally honest about your dimensions and if possible have a friend to give feedback on your outfit. Experiment with different hats. If you are shorter, a huge wide brimmed hat may be overpowering so go for smaller size or a fascinator; for more visual impact you could could try bolder colours and trimmings.\"

\"Millinery comes in many exciting colours, textures and patterns. Prints can be overwhelming, so lean towards block colours with variations on shades. Try to choose colours complimentary to your skin tone. Dark skin tones will suit reds, whereas aqua blues, pinks are well executed with paler tones. Make-up should be toned down if there is a lot happening with a hat: remember this is Derby Day and not a Brazilian carnival.\"
